The number of rental properties available per branch fell from 208 in August to 193 in September – the same number seen in September 2019. ARLA Propertymark’s latest survey finds the number of renters experiencing rent increases fell by almost a fifth year-on-year in September; 40% of agents witnessed landlords increasing rent compared with 48% in August – 18% lower than in September 2019, when the figure stood at 58%. Fifty-four per cent of respondents said landlords were unwilling to work with tenants who could not afford to pay rent. The results of the FMTA’s COVID Landlord Survey showed 65 per cent of tenants said landlords are still giving them rent increases during the pandemic.
